Energy efficiency
Double glazed windows are a fantastic way to boost your home's energy efficiency. They are able to trap heat within the home and help reduce energy bills. They're also great for the environment since they reduce the carbon footprint of your home. They're even a great option for older buildings that require to upgrade their energy efficiency.
Double-glazed windows can be a great investment. They can help you reduce your energy costs and increase the value of your home. It is crucial to select a reputable installer who can provide quality products. Always use an approved installer to make sure your windows are able to meet the minimum energy rating of 7 stars.
Compared to single-pane windows, double-glazed windows are more efficient as they have an air gap between the panes. This gap lets light pass through but also acts as an insulator. This makes it less likely for heat to escape from your home and makes it easier to maintain the temperature.
Additionally, double glazing can stop condensation from forming on the window's surface. This helps to minimize damage to furniture, carpets, and paintings. The airtight seal created between the two panes of glass also helps block out noise from the outside. This is particularly helpful for those living in noisy areas.

Security
Double-glazed windows offer enhanced security features over single-glazing. They are constructed of toughened glass with a strong frame. They are difficult to break, and even more difficult to slam shut making it much more difficult for burglars your home. They help protect furniture by filtering harmful UV rays.
This kind of window is also energy efficient. The space between the two panes of glass retains air, which is a poor conductor of heat. This helps keep the outside of the windows cooler and the inside of the house warmer. This results in a significant decrease in heating bills and a decrease of carbon emissions.
Another benefit of double glazing is that it minimizes condensation and mistiness. This is a common issue in older single-pane windows but double glazing helps prevent this from occurring by keeping the inside of the window at a higher temperature than the air outside.
The space between the panes of double glazing are filled with Argon gas, which is an inert substance that increases the thermal performance of windows. This gas has an extremely low thermal conductivity which keeps the windows insulated and lowers energy bills. It is also an environmentally friendly option that is not contaminated and environmentally friendly. Double-glazing systems can be effective at reducing noise. This is perfect for homeowners who live near a busy road or are concerned about neighbors talking.
